The Communication and Information Agency of Uzbekistan is the Coordinating Administration Body, authorized to problem solution and carrying out the state policy in sphere of communication, information and using the radio-frequency spectrum. Under the Decree of the President of the Republic of Uzbekistan ? DP-3080, of May 30, 2002 “On the further development of computerization and information-communication technologies implementation” the Post and Telecommunication Agency of Uzbekistan which was formed in 1997 on the basis of former Communication Ministry of the Republic of Uzbekistan reformed to the Communication and Information Agency of Uzbekistan.

The structure and activity basis of the Communication and Information Agency is defined by the Decree of the President of Republic of Uzbekistan ? DP-3080, of May 30, 2002 “On the further development of computerization and information-communication technologies implementation”, and also by the Resolutions of the Cabinet of Ministers of the Republic of Uzbekistan ?200, of June 6, 2002 “Concerning the actions on further development of computerization and information-communication technologies implementation”; and ?215, of May 7, 2004 “Concerning the actions on development of activities of the Communication and Information Agency of Uzbekistan». The Communication and Information Agency of Uzbekistan is the Operating Body of the Coordinating Council on development of computerization and information-communication technologies. The Statute about the Communication and Information Agency of Uzbekistan is approved by the Resolutions of the Republic of Uzbekistan ?215, of May 7, 2004 “Concerning the actions on development of activities of the Communication and Information Agency of Uzbekistan”. |
